About Louise Soanes
Louise Soanes is a scholar working on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health, Speech and Hearing and Issues, ethics and legal aspects, having authored 29 papers that have together received 471 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Childhood Cancer Survivors' Quality of Life (24 papers), Family Support in Illness (18 papers) and Adolescent and Pediatric Healthcare (6 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health (298 citations), Speech and Hearing (97 citations) and Research and Theory (9 citations). Louise Soanes has collaborated with scholars based in United Kingdom, Sweden and United States. Frequent co-authors include Faith Gibson, Lorna A. Fern, Darren Hargrave, Sue Morgan, Rachel M. Taylor, Dan Stark, Ana Martins, Nathalie Gaspar, Giannis Mountzios and Jean-Yves Douillard. Their work appears in journals such as Annals of Oncology, European Journal of Cancer and BMC Cancer.
